I'm installing an older Sony unit and went and bought 2 small speakers and installed them behind the speaker grille on the dash.

If I had to choose (which I do) am I better to hook these to what would have been the front or the rear speakers?
 
John-Peter, I don't believe it matters.

On car stereo's the front and back channels carry the same sound (unless you have something like Dolby surround which I doubt).

Just don't use 2 left channels, or 2 right channels and you should be OK.

Whatever channels you do use (front or back), make sure you adjust the fader on your radio to what you chose.
